Transaction 8833ccfaa1e539faf3a823d3da05946b477bcc485dfcaf5a89d93224f06ed2a7
1 Input
1 Output
-
8833ccfaa1e539faf3a823d3da05946b477bcc485dfcaf5a89d93224f06ed2a7:0
- value
- 23342624
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9f41d439391525ed390d1817c95e4c0b8dd8569 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LsS4zFCHKgwX3eLKP282zQ4vWWaaaavou